While preparing for the exhibition, I managed to make some time for this drawing.
I used a simple thirds grid to help me place the drawing on the paper. This is part of my transitioning to just working by sight with no grid. I find with the practice I'm improving with my placement forms in relation to each other, and thus keeping things in proportion.
